Stocks retreat from record highs U.S. stock market losses led by small companies Earnings season kicks off with Alcoa on Tuesday NEW YORK (MarketWatch) — The U.S. stock market fell on Monday, with the tech and small companies leading the losses. The main benchmarks retreated from record levels reached Thursday, as investors gear up for the second-quarter earnings season. http://www.marketwatch.com/story/us-stocks-futures-slip-adm-in-3-billion-deal-2014-07-07
